🙂Monthly costs for one person with rent: $1,144 in Ramnicu Sarat versus $1,373 in Cluj-Napoca.
🙂Estimated couple costs with rent: $1,790 in Ramnicu Sarat versus $2,113 in Cluj-Napoca.
🙂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$2,436 in Ramnicu Sarat versus $2,854 in Cluj-Napoca.
🌍Living in Ramnicu Sarat costs roughly 17% less than in Cluj-Napoca, driven mainly by Eating Out.
📊The two cities straddle the global median: Ramnicu Sarat is 14% below, Cluj-Napoca is 3% above.

🏠A one-bedroom apartment in the center runs $383 in Ramnicu Sarat and $710 in Cluj-Napoca. Housing cost is often the main lever when comparing two cities.
🛒Dining out: $70.0 in Ramnicu Sarat vs $57.0 in Cluj-Napoca. Groceries flip the comparison at $228 vs $234, with Ramnicu Sarat cheaper for home cooking.
